Pakistan, July 20 -- Deputy Prime Minister/Foreign Minister, Senator Mohammad Ishaq Dar, will visit the United States next week to attend the high-level signature events of Pakistan's UN Security Council (UNSC) Presidency in New York, as well as for certain engagements in Washington.

According to a statement issued by Foreign Office Spokesperson Shafqat Ali Khan on Saturday, in New York, as part of Pakistan's Security Council signature events, the DPM/FM will chair a high-level Open Debate on "Promoting International Peace and Security through Multilateralism and Peaceful Settlement of Disputes".
